Output e889311451c9f55fd2ddded3868388f262dadad123185f99395c7771fc8f477d:0

value
170520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82968ab81affee2d6fe3a7625ad724b1a6628793 OP_EQUAL
address
3DbW7KBf38NDuuYDuiy3sWyHiqXVAc5Bjf
transaction
e889311451c9f55fd2ddded3868388f262dadad123185f99395c7771fc8f477d
spent
true